Course Content

• Traffic Impact Assessment Methodologies
• Transportation Planning and Modelling (including microsimulation and traffic flow theory)
• Data Collection and Analysis for Traffic Impact Evaluation
• Traffic Impact Evaluation Software and Tools
• Environmental Impact Assessment and Traffic
• Transport Sustainability and Traffic Management Strategies
• Legal and Regulatory Frameworks for Traffic Impact Assessment
• Case Studies in Traffic Impact Evaluation

Career path

Career Role Description
Traffic Impact Assessment Consultant Conducting TIA studies, advising on transport planning and mitigating traffic impacts. High demand in urban development.
Transportation Planner (Traffic Modeling) Developing and using traffic models to forecast traffic flows and assess the effectiveness of transport schemes. Strong analytical skills required.
Highway Engineer (Traffic Management) Designing and implementing traffic management solutions, ensuring safe and efficient road networks. Expertise in traffic signal design is a plus.
Transport Data Analyst Analyzing large datasets to identify trends and patterns in traffic, informing transport policy and investment decisions. Data visualisation skills essential.
